How can I show respect to myself?
Respecting oneself is a fundamental aspect of personal growth and well-being. It involves acknowledging one’s worth, valuing one’s time, and making choices that promote personal happiness and fulfillment. In this article, we will explore various ways to show respect to oneself, helping you cultivate a healthier, more balanced life.
First and foremost,
self-awareness is key to respecting oneself.
By understanding our strengths, weaknesses, and values, we can make informed decisions that align with our true selves. This means taking the time to reflect on our thoughts, emotions, and behaviors, and recognizing the impact they have on our overall well-being. By becoming more self-aware, we can begin to make choices that honor our personal values and promote self-respect.
Setting boundaries is another crucial step in showing respect to oneself.
Boundaries protect us from being taken advantage of and allow us to focus on our personal growth. Establishing clear limits in relationships, work, and personal time helps us maintain a sense of balance and prioritize our well-being. Remember, it is okay to say no when necessary, and setting boundaries is a reflection of self-respect.
Taking care of one’s physical health is essential for showing respect to oneself.
Regular exercise, a balanced diet, and adequate sleep are fundamental to our physical and mental well-being. By making time for self-care and adopting healthy habits, we demonstrate that we value our own happiness and longevity. Remember, taking care of our bodies is an act of self-respect.
Engaging in activities that bring joy and fulfillment is a powerful way to show respect to oneself.
Whether it’s pursuing a hobby, spending time with loved ones, or engaging in creative expression, activities that bring us joy are essential for maintaining a positive outlook on life. By nurturing our passions and interests, we honor our unique qualities and show ourselves that we are worthy of happiness and growth.
Self-compassion is a vital component of respecting oneself.
Beating ourselves up over mistakes or setbacks is counterproductive and disrespectful. Instead, practice self-compassion by treating yourself with kindness and understanding. Remind yourself that it’s okay to make mistakes and that you are worthy of love and support. Self-compassion helps build resilience and promotes a healthier self-image.
Finally, seeking out opportunities for personal growth and development demonstrates self-respect.
By continuously learning and expanding our horizons, we show ourselves that we are committed to becoming the best version of ourselves. Whether it’s through education, travel, or exploring new interests, investing in personal growth is a reflection of our respect for ourselves and our desire to lead a fulfilling life.
